Choosing Aluminum Downpipes : Advantages and Factors

When replacing your rainwater system, aluminum downpipes present a attractive option. These are known for their exceptional durability, resisting corrosion and rust far better than other materials. In addition , aluminium is relatively lightweight, making installation and minimizing the stress on your structure . However, remember the initial cost, which can be a bit higher than PVC alternatives, and the possibility need for experienced fitting to ensure a proper seal and functionality . In conclusion, carefully evaluate these factors to decide if aluminum downpipes are the right choice for your property .

Installing Aluminium Downpipes: A Step-by-Step Guide

Replacing or installing fresh aluminium pipes can appear a tricky project, but with precise planning and execution, it's definitely achievable for the average homeowner. This quick guide will present the key steps. First, collect your supplies: a measuring ruler , a cutter , a bore, screws, supports , and sealant caulk. Next, assess the distance of the existing downspout and trim the new aluminium pipes to the appropriate size. Attach the hangers to the eaves of your home at regular intervals – typically around 6 to 8 feet . Slowly place the downspout into the hangers, guaranteeing a firm fit. Finally, spread silicone caulk around all connections to minimize seepage.

Maintaining Your Aluminium Downpipes for Longevity

To maintain the extended life of your metal downpipes, periodic cleaning is vital. Leaves, such as dropped leaves, check here twigs , and mud , can accumulate and block the movement of water, potentially causing leaks to your drainage system . Consider a thorough assessment at minimum twice a season , and clear any blockages you see. A careful cleaning with a soft brush and water can also aid to remove discoloration .

The Cost of Aluminium Downpipes: A Complete Breakdown

Understanding the cost of aluminium downpipes can be challenging, but this guide will offer a complete overview . The total price range typically falls between $5 and $15 for each foot, but several factors influence the real amount . These encompass the distance of the run , the difficulty of the placement, the prevailing commodity values, and fitting rates. Also, choosing alternative styles , such as custom downpipes, will raise the job's price . Finally, keep in mind that quotes from several contractors are vital for securing the lowest price .
